Flooding in Ghana's Upper East Region Causes Water Pollution and Sanitation Risks
Communities in Ghana's Upper East region are facing water pollution and sanitation risks due to recurring floods, exacerbated by erratic rainfall and the annual spillage of Burkina Faso's Bagre Dam.
